The Aftermath

The Aftermath

4.2IMDb Score
Released:1982-03-22
Duration:95 min
Director:Steve Barkett
Actors:Steve Barkett, Lynne Margulies, Sid Haig, Christopher Barkett, Alfie Martin
Production:The Nautilus Film Company

Overview:

After a lengthy space mission, two astronauts return to an Earth transformed by nuclear war. As renegade gangs and mutants rule Los Angeles, the astronauts join two pretty women and a couple of kids in a growing resistance movement.
